A tango written by Giacomo Puccini? Indeed! In 1942 'Piccolo Tango' by the Italian opera composer was published by an American music publisher. The question as to whether it was actually composed by Puccini has not been confirmed - but the heirs had the work protected by copyright, thus confirming Puccini's authorship. In the years 1907 and 1910 the composer took one trip each to the United States. It might be possible that Puccini wrote the little tango on that occasion, thus showing his reverence to the host country with bold jazzy harmonies. And he was not the only classical composer who dared to take an excursion into the realm of entertaining music, for even fellow composers such as Igor Stravinsky or Kurt Weill, Erwin Schulhoff or Isaac Albéniz were tempted to compose a tango too.
